Credit matters — but it's only one part of the picture. Whether a specific vehicle actually works depends on you, the vehicle, and how the deal itself is structured.
Being able to finance around $25,000 doesn't mean every $25,000 vehicle represents the same deal. A newer car with low mileage and a three-year-old car with higher mileage can carry very different financing situations at the same sticker price.
That score is genuinely useful information — but it's a consumer credit score. Auto lenders often use a different scoring model built specifically around auto-lending risk, and they generally weigh more than a score alone: income, employment history, the vehicle itself, and how the deal is structured.
That's why ShiftSimple starts with the whole picture — not just a score.

The financeability engine's rate assumptions and dealer credit-tier tags are built around this landscape — from major banks and credit unions at the top of the credit spectrum to the specialty finance companies that write deep subprime paper other lenders won't touch.
| Credit tier | Typical used-vehicle APR* | Representative lenders active in this tier |
|---|---|---|
| Super-prime 781–850 FICO |
~6–7% | Bank of America, Chase Auto, PenFed Credit Union, Navy Federal Credit Union, Alliant Credit Union, USAA (military-affiliated) |
| Prime 661–780 FICO |
~8–9.5% | Capital One Auto Navigator, Ally Auto, Chase Auto, Bank of America, most local and regional credit unions (commonly reached via CUDL) |
| Near-prime 601–660 FICO |
~10–14.5% | Ally Financial, Capital One, Global Lending Services (GLS), Regional Acceptance Corporation, community credit unions |
| Subprime 501–600 FICO |
~14.5–19.5% | Santander Consumer USA, Westlake Financial, Prestige Financial Services, American Credit Acceptance, Exeter Finance |
| Deep subprime 300–500 FICO |
~15.5–21.5%+ | Credit Acceptance Corporation, Consumer Portfolio Services (CPS), Westlake Financial, First Investors Financial Services, Buy Here Pay Here in-house programs |
*Directional averages compiled from Experian's State of the Automotive Finance Market and Bankrate's weekly rate survey, 2026. Actual offers vary by state, lender, term length, vehicle age, and loan-to-value — always confirm current terms directly with the lender before structuring a deal.
